Temporary closure of a section of Taïeb Mehiri Street in Tunis for six months

by Webdo
Monday 3 November 2025 16:08
in National

From Tuesday November 4, 2025 at 1:00 a.m.

As part of the completion of the “D” section of the Rapid Rail Network (RFR) project, the company Tunis RFR announces the temporary closure of part of rue Taïeb Mehiri, between rue Bach Hamba and rue Yougourta, in both directions, for a period of six months from November 4, 2025 at 1:00 a.m.

Diversion routes have been put in place in coordination with local authorities and traffic police:

  • From Place du Bardo towards M’Lassine: motorists can pass through the entrance to the CNAM (National Health Insurance Fund) then join Avenue de la République before turning left towards Rue Taïeb Mehiri.
  • From M’Lassine towards Place du Bardo: it will be possible to turn right towards Rue de la Liberté towards Avenue du 20 Mars 1956, or to continue straight then turn right via Rue Yougourta to reach the same avenue.

In addition, traffic will also be prohibited in several streets adjacent to the construction site, on the Taïeb Mehiri street side, namely:

  • Rue Farhat Hached
  • Arbi Zarrouk Street
  • Rue du 13 Août (rue de la Municipalité)

These restrictions will remain in effect until the work is completed.

The company finally calls on all road users to exercise caution, reduce speed and respect the temporary signage put in place in the construction site area.
